Output 81aba95ed54e676d36578ba853be03b4fa469a1b472b139869e4eeec86619f72:5

value
259590518
script pubkey
OP_0 OP_PUSHBYTES_20 2e7639c528524fc66587601f64c94bca0e8d651b
address
bc1q9emrn3fg2f8uvev8vq0kfj2teg8g6egm53dcc8
transaction
81aba95ed54e676d36578ba853be03b4fa469a1b472b139869e4eeec86619f72
spent
true